Been to the vets with Otis,badly hurt leg,poss broken
My gorgeous Hedgehog hurt himself,we dont know how,we think he may have fallen off his wheel,he is on pain killers and the vet said the treatment was the same for a break as a bad sprain,it is so upsetting,have to put half a drop of medicine in his food If not better in a few days they will put him out and xray it,I am so worried
